RGB vs RGBIC: Understanding the Technology

Standard RGB panels display one color across all panels simultaneously. RGBIC (Red, Green, Blue, Independent Control) allows different colors on different sections or edges of the same panel. For gaming rooms, I recommend RGBIC. The dynamic effects create more immersive atmospheres that standard RGB cannot match.

Govee’s patented RGBIC technology displays up to 24 colors simultaneously across a single panel set. Nanoleaf’s RGBW adds white LEDs for purer pastel tones. Both technologies outperform basic RGB for gaming ambiance.

Installation Methods: Adhesive vs Mounting Brackets

All panels I tested use adhesive mounting, which works well on smooth, painted walls. However, I learned several lessons the hard way. Clean the wall with rubbing alcohol before applying adhesive. Wait 24 hours before attaching panels to let the adhesive cure. For textured walls or rental situations, consider 3M Command strips as an alternative.

The Govee Glide Wall Lights use velcro instead of permanent adhesive, making them the best choice for renters. Nanoleaf and Govee hexagon panels use sticky backing that can damage paint when removed. Budget options typically include adhesive pads that vary in quality.

Expandability: Planning Your Future Setup

Nanoleaf leads in expandability, supporting up to 500 panels in a single installation. Govee mini panels support 70 per adapter, while hexagon panels typically max at 12 per power unit. Budget options rarely support expansion beyond the included set.

Before buying, sketch your ideal final configuration. If you want to cover an entire wall eventually, start with an expandable system. My recommendation: choose a brand and stick with it. Mixing Nanoleaf and Govee in the same room creates app management headaches.

Power Consumption and Long-Term Costs

Power draw varies significantly. The Govee Gaming Wall Light uses 72 watts at full brightness, while budget hexagon panels typically draw 10 watts or less. At average electricity rates, running panels 6 hours daily costs approximately $2-15 annually depending on the product.

LED lifespan ratings of 30,000-50,000 hours are theoretical maximums. Real-world forum discussions with professional installers suggest 6-8 years is realistic for consumer LED wall panels in indoor gaming rooms. Heat and humidity reduce lifespan, so avoid mounting near radiators or in unventilated spaces.

Gaming Integration: Sync Technologies Explained

Screen mirroring captures your monitor colors and replicates them on panels. Nanoleaf’s Screen Mirror works through a PC app and delivers the best results I tested. Govee’s DreamView requires a separate sync box for HDMI pass-through, adding cost but supporting consoles and any HDMI source.

Music sync reacts to audio through microphone or app processing. All tested products include this feature, though quality varies. Premium options process audio faster with less delay. Budget options use simpler microphone-based detection that works adequately but less precisely.

What is the best wall color for a gaming room?

Neutral gray or off-white walls work best for gaming rooms as they reflect RGB lighting without adding unwanted color casts. Darker walls absorb light, requiring brighter panels. Pure white can look clinical; warm gray provides the ideal backdrop for LED effects. Matte finishes diffuse light better than glossy paints, creating smoother ambient effects.
